Weaviate · Schema

ReplicationAsyncConfig

Configuration for asynchronous replication.

Properties

Name Type Description
maxWorkers integer Maximum number of async replication workers.
hashtreeHeight integer Height of the hashtree used for diffing.
frequency integer Base frequency in milliseconds at which async replication runs diff calculations.
frequencyWhilePropagating integer Frequency in milliseconds at which async replication runs while propagation is active.
aliveNodesCheckingFrequency integer Interval in milliseconds at which liveness of target nodes is checked.
loggingFrequency integer Interval in seconds at which async replication logs its status.
diffBatchSize integer Maximum number of object keys included in a single diff batch.
diffPerNodeTimeout integer Timeout in seconds for computing a diff against a single node.
prePropagationTimeout integer Overall timeout in seconds for the pre-propagation phase.
propagationTimeout integer Timeout in seconds for propagating batch of changes to a node.
propagationLimit integer Maximum number of objects to propagate in a single async replication run.
propagationDelay integer Delay in milliseconds before newly added or updated objects are propagated.
propagationConcurrency integer Maximum number of concurrent propagation workers.
propagationBatchSize integer Number of objects to include in a single propagation batch.
